Construction of Highly Nonlinear 1-Resilient Boolean Functions with Optimal Algebraic Immunity and Provably High Fast Algebraic Immunity

IEEE Transactions on Information Theory, 2017
In 2013, Tang, Carlet, and Tang [IEEE TIT 59(1): 653–664, 2013] presented two classes of Boolean functions. The functions in the first class are unbalanced and the functions in the second one are balanced. Both of those two classes of functions have high nonlinearity, high algebraic degree, optimal algebraic immunity, and high fast algebraic immunity ...

Highly Nonlinear Boolean Functions With Optimal Algebraic Immunity and Good Behavior Against Fast Algebraic Attacks

IEEE Transactions on Information Theory, 2013
Inspired by the previous work of Tu and Deng, we propose two infinite classes of Boolean functions of 2k variables where k ≥ 2. The first class contains unbalanced functions having high algebraic degree and nonlinearity. The functions in the second one are balanced and have maximal algebraic degree and high nonlinearity (as shown by a lower bound that ...

Revised Algorithms for Computing Algebraic Immunity against Algebraic and Fast Algebraic Attacks

2014
Given a Boolean function with n variables, a revised algorithm for computing the algebraic immunity d against conventional algebraic attacks in O(D 2±e ) complexity is described for \(D=\sum _{i = 0}^d {n \choose i}\) and a small e, which corrects and clarifies the most efficient algorithm so far at Eurocrypt 2006.
